“When the pigeons return, it feels like home.”

It’s this feeling that draws Loubna Hamdan to her rooftop each evening as the sun dips behind Beirut’s concrete skyline.

Here, she is greeted by dozens of pigeons circling above. It’s a place where the 36-year-old office worker has found quiet refuge — a love for birds first introduced to her by her husband, Ibrahim Ammar, who has raised them since childhood.

Together, they scatter food, provide water and keep watch for any bird that seems weak or injured, attentively tending to the winged creatures.
